第十七章 排程 SCHEDULING
章節概要 作業排程 在少量系統中的排程 額外的服務考量 作業策略 在大量系統中的排程 在中量系統中的排程 排程的目的: 目標之間取得權衡取捨 人員 設備 設施…
排程: 在組織中建立使用設備和設施,及人們活動的時程 1.作業排程 排程: 在組織中建立使用設備和設施,及人們活動的時程 例如: 製造單位的每日,週,月 生產報表 醫院的醫生排班 汽車修理場的排程 目的: 人員,設備,設施有效的利用 MIN { 客戶等候時間,存貨,加工時間 }
製造作業的排程 大量 中量 少量 服務作業 1月 2月 3月 4月 5月 6月 建造 A A 完成 建造 B B 完成 建造 C C 完成 建造 D 運送 1月 2月 3月 4月 5月 6月 準時! 大量 中量 少量 服務作業
流程系統 flow system: 有標準化設備與活動的大量系統 流程工廠的排程 flow-shop scheduling: 為流程系統排程 ★ 大量系統的排程 流程系統 flow system: 有標準化設備與活動的大量系統 流程工廠的排程 flow-shop scheduling: 為流程系統排程 工作中心 #1 工作中心 #2 產出
流程系統相關議題(p.731) 生產線平衡: 高度平衡使用率,產出率 較大 員工的厭煩心態 問題: 現實狀況很少只生產一種產品 系統中斷:緊急外包,加班 實際需求比原預測還少:上4天 休3天
大量系統成功的因素 製程與產品設計(成本,易製性) 預防性維修 當發生故障時迅速修理 最佳的產品組合 使品質問題最小化 可靠度與供應時程
產出介於大量系統的標準產出與零工式工廠依訂單製造的產出之間 經濟生產批量: ★ 中量系統的排程 產出介於大量系統的標準產出與零工式工廠依訂單製造的產出之間 經濟生產批量: 重點: 整備成本的考量,包括時間 考慮FMS 參考p.532 (公式13-5)
零工式工廠 每張訂單差異可能很大 2.少量系統中的排程 零工式工廠排程: 在需求上有許多變動的少量系統中的排程 安排負荷: 指派工作到加工中心 排程 :決定所要加工工作的次序 問題1 零工式工廠 每張訂單差異可能很大 問題2
安排負荷的方法 整備成本最小化 工作中心之閒置時間最小化 工作完成時間最小化
甘特圖 甘特圖 Gantt chart: 為了安排負荷與排程的目的,用以視覺輔助的圖 參考 圖17-1
負荷圖 負荷圖 load chart: 針對一群機器或部門,顯示其安排負荷與閒置時間的甘特圖,亦稱為甘特負荷圖
甘特負荷圖 Gantt load chart 圖 17-2 資 源 排程 時間
安排負荷 無限負荷法 infinite loading 有限負荷法 finite loading 垂直負荷法 vertical loading 水平負荷法 horizontal loading 向前排程法 forward scheduling 向後排程法 backward scheduling 日程圖 schedule chart
無限負荷法 infinite loading 安排負荷 無限負荷法 infinite loading 不考慮工作中心的產能 可能會有工作中心會有等侯or不足的問題 如:優先順序排序法 有限負荷法 finite loading 依各工作中心的實際開始與停上時間 會考慮工作中心的產能&加工時間 不會產生超過產能的情形 配合排程須經常性update
無限負荷法 & 有限負荷法 比較圖 p.735
垂直負荷法 vertical loading 安排負荷 垂直負荷法 vertical loading 在一個工作中心逐件安排工作負荷 通常依照某種優先順序,採用 無限負荷法 比較偏向局部考量 水平負荷法 horizontal loading 在全部的需求工作中心安排每件工作的負荷 一次只安排一件工作 通常依照某種優先順序,採用 有限負荷法 比較偏向整體考量
向前排程法 forward scheduling 安排負荷 向前排程法 forward scheduling 從某個時間向前排程 適用於 完成此問題須多久時間 向後排程法 backward scheduling 從到期日向後排程 適用於 工作最遲何時開始 日程圖 schedule chart 顯示訂單or工作進度,是否符合日程的甘特圖 參考圖17-3 可用於專題 較難顯示成本,但現有軟體可支援(P3) 參考圖17-4 範例
Hungarian method 以一對一的搭配方式指派工作,共確定最低成本的方法 六大步驟(p.739) 參考 例題1
排序 排序: 決定在工作中心中所要加工工作的次序 工作站: 一個人員工作的區域,通常有專用的設備,用於特定的工作
優先順序法則 : 用來選擇欲處理工作次序的一種簡單啟發式方法. 排序 優先順序法則 : 用來選擇欲處理工作次序的一種簡單啟發式方法. 工作時間: 整備與處理工作所需的時間 每件事都是 第一優先
FCFS -先到先服務(局部用) First come, first served 優先順序法則 表 17-2 FCFS -先到先服務(局部用) First come, first served SPT -最短處理時間(局部用) Shortest processing time EDD -到期日(局部用) Earliest due date 四大假設
CR-關鍵性比率(整體用) Critical ratio 優先順序法則(續) 表 17-2(續) CR-關鍵性比率(整體用) Critical ratio S/O-每個作業的寬裕時間(整體用) Slack per operation Rush-緊急事件(局部用+整體用)
工作流程時間(天) Job flow time 衡量排序的積效 工作流程時間(天) Job flow time 某項工作停留在工作站(工作中心)的時間長度 包括處理時間,等待時間,搬運時間,因故障,欠料等時間 平均流程時間 = 工作總流程時間 / 工作數目 工作延遲時間(天) Job lateness 即實際完工時間與到期日之差 工作延後時間 job tardiness
衡量排序的積效 總完工時間 makespan 工作中心內的平均工作數 完成一群工作所需的總時間 工作群中的最早開始至最晚完成的總時間 在製品存貨數目 平均工作數 = 總流程時間 / 總完工時間
Processing time (days) 例題 2 題目: 計算 FCFS, SPT, EDD, CR Job Processing time (days) Due Date (days) A 2 7 B 8 16 C 4 D 10 17 E 5 15 F 12 18
例題 2 SPT最佳 CR方法最不好,FCFS次之 表 17-4 :解答 法則 工作中心內的 平均工作數 平均流程時間 平均延後時間 20.00 9.00 2.93 SPT 18.00 6.67 2.63 EDD 18.33 6.33 2.68 CR 22.17 9.67 3.24 SPT最佳 CR方法最不好,FCFS次之
Johnson’s 法則: 使一群欲在兩部機器或二個連續工作中心處理工作的總完工時間最小化的方法 流經兩個工作中心的工作排序 Johnson’s 法則: 使一群欲在兩部機器或二個連續工作中心處理工作的總完工時間最小化的方法 使總閒置時間最小化 必須要滿足5個條件
所有的工作都必須依照相同的兩步驟工作順序 不能使用工作優先順序法則 在移往第二個工作中心之前,該工作在第一個工作中心的所有單位數必須都已完工 Johnson’s 法則的條件 工作時間必須是已知且固定不變 工作時間必須與工作順序無關 所有的工作都必須依照相同的兩步驟工作順序 不能使用工作優先順序法則 在移往第二個工作中心之前,該工作在第一個工作中心的所有單位數必須都已完工 排序步驟 參考 p.749 參考例題4
其他議題 整備時間的考量,參考p.752 範例 管理者可能採取的做法 限制理論 TOC, Theory Of Constraints drum-buffer-rope
3. 額外的服務考量 ※ 服務作業的問題 服務無法以存貨儲存 顧客要求服務是隨機的 服務的排程涉及: 顧客 工作人員 設備
服務業的排程 預約系統 保留系統 工作人員的排程 多重資源的排程 對於服務顧客的管制,min{等待} 顧客 估計服務的需求 管理服務的產能 協調一種以上資源的使用 顧客